Childhood friends hailing from Walthamstow, East London – Shanghai Bluesare James Chalk (Vocals, Bass), Reece Ismael (Guitar), James Heed (Guitar) and Mike Stinton (Drums). Although having only formed two years ago, Shanghai Blues have already travelled the length and breadth of the UK and continue to sell out shows to their ever-growing fanbase. 

Known for their raucous live stage presence, they have already made a name for themselves with slots at The Great Escape (Alt) and City Sound Project, alongside tour dates with Neon Waltz, Glass Caves, Theme Park, Palace, The Rifles, JUDAS and Y.O.U.N.G, with their shows drawing the attention of Music Week, The Evening Standard and NME

The band have already featured on several tastemaker playlists includingThe Indie List, Hot New Bands and Fresh Finds, plus support at Apple Music (Best OfThe Week) and from Abbie McCarthy (BBC Introducing, Radio 1). 

Off the back of their hit single ‘LIES’, the band have found a comfort within their sound and from this has come a vast maturity to their songwriting. This coupled with a hugely diverse array of influences from artists including Jimi Hendrix and Dinosaur Pile-Up has helped create emotive songs that speak on many levels.
